There are a few ways to remove stains from car seats. You can use a bucket and white vinegar, pour the solution over the stain, and let it sit for a few minutes. Then, use a scrub brush to scrub the stain until it comes out. You can also use hydrogen peroxide on stubborn stains. Pour the hydrogen peroxide over the stain, wait five minutes, and then scrub with a scrub brush.
